Visitors are never to be taken into Storage Room C-12, where Quillhaven keeps spare laptops, monitors, and networking hardware. If a night-shift contractor needs equipment, verify the request against the facilities ticket queue, retrieve the item yourself, and record it in the paper log inside the door. Lock the room immediately afterward and confirm the latch engages. The C-12 keypad accepts the night-access code below.

door code, yagap-bahof: bdg-O-05

Test plan — ThanksDrop receipt mailer v2

Scope: receipt generation, template rendering, retry queue. Out of scope: bounce handling.

Cases: duplicate donation IDs must not double-send; zero-amount donations skipped; currency formatting per locale; retry caps at three attempts.

Run against the Harborline sandbox only. Fixtures live in the mailer repo under /testdata. Authenticate sandbox API calls with the token below.

login token, bagug-kafop: eyJhbGciOiJIUzI1NiIsInR5cCI6IkpXVCJ9.eyJzdWIiOiIcMLov2In0.Z5RLDIfp

Excerpt for security review. Orders placed after the daily cutoff roll to the next fulfillment day. Cutoff is evaluated server-side only; client clocks are ignored. The check compares order timestamp against the store's configured cutoff in its local zone, with a grace window for in-flight checkouts. Tampering vector considered: replayed checkout tokens near the boundary — mitigated by single-use tokens expiring within the grace window. No admin override path exists in v1. The relevant constants are below.

tuning table, yajog-yahof:
BUDGETS = {
    "lamvan": 303,
    "wenox": 460,
    "fenvan": 525,
}

Finance Review Summary – Orvala Group

Sale of the Tellweather Instruments unit completed. Gross consideration within the approved range; net proceeds after advisory fees and working-capital adjustment slightly above forecast. Warranty escrow held for eighteen months. Stranded costs identified and scheduled for elimination by year-end. No material disputes outstanding. The confidential note on forward business plans follows immediately below for board reference.

board note of baweg-bawig: Project Tamath slips by six weeks because of the audit delay.